With Qwickly Jot, students can write on diagrams, charts, maps and more inside the learning management system. Now, with the new instructor markup tool, instructors are empowered to provide detailed, personalized feedback on student submissions. This feature allows instructors to directly annotate and correct student work, imitating the traditional pen-and-paper experience.

How it Works:

Qwickly Jot provides instructors with a seamless platform to review student submissions. Within the platform, educators can directly access individual student work. Using the annotation tool, instructors can provide specific feedback directly on the student's document. Different colors can be assigned to different feedback types, such as corrections, suggestions, or positive reinforcement. Once the review is complete, instructors can assign a numerical grade to the assignment, which is then automatically transferred over to the Learning Management System (LMS) gradebook. This user-friendly approach empowers educators to deliver immediate grading and feedback to their students.
